This live sand utilizes Sea Breathe laser technology which preserves real live sand with its own original bacteria. If you were to rinse the sand, it would appear much less cloudy, but you would destroy all of the beneficial bacteria which is half the point of live sand in the first place! Should I rinse sand? For some sands the answer is yes, but with all of the sand on this this, the answer is a no. How much sand should I buy? That will really depend on the footprint of your tank and how deep you want to go.
